Understanding Different Sorts Of Lawn Sprinkler Equipments
While examining different automatic sprinkler, homeowners will certainly discover a number of alternatives tailored to different landscape design requirements. The most typical types include drip irrigation, spray lawn sprinklers, and rotary lawn sprinklers. Leak irrigation delivers water straight to the plant roots, making it extremely efficient for gardens and flower beds. Spray lawn sprinklers, which disperse water in a fan-shaped pattern, are ideal for tiny to medium lawns and can cover specific locations effectively. Rotary lawn sprinklers, on the other hand, release water in a revolving way, making them suitable for bigger lawns where even protection is essential. Sprinkler system check. Home owners might also take into consideration soaker pipes, which are made to seep water gradually along their size, providing a gentle irrigation technique. Each system has its advantages and is best suited for specific landscaping types, making sure that house owners can choose the most appropriate automatic sprinkler for their special outdoor environments
Reviewing Water Pressure and Supply
Just how can home owners assure their lawn sprinkler system operates efficiently? Examining water pressure and supply is crucial in this process. House owners must first gauge their water stress, normally ranging from 30 to 80 psi. A pressure gauge can be connected to an outside tap for precise analyses. Low tide stress may necessitate the installment of a booster pump, while exceedingly high stress can harm the lawn sprinkler and need stress regulation.Additionally, examining the water is crucial. Homeowners should take into consideration the quantity of water available, particularly during height usage hours. This can be figured out by calculating the output of numerous taps or pipes running concurrently. Guaranteeing that the water system fulfills the system's needs will stop completely dry areas and uneven watering in the landscape. By addressing both water stress and supply, home owners can choose an appropriate lawn sprinkler that meets their landscape design needs effectively.

Seasonal Adjustments Needed
As the seasons adjustment, adjusting the automatic sprinkler becomes vital for preserving its performance and guaranteeing suitable plant wellness. In springtime, property owners need to increase watering period to suit new growth, while keeping track of rains to stop overwatering. Summertime frequently requires the most significant modifications; timers might need to be readied to run during cooler hours to minimize evaporation. As fall methods, decreasing watering regularity permits plants to plan for dormancy. In winter season, many systems must be winterized to prevent damage from freezing temperature levels. Routinely changing the system and checking based on seasonal needs not only promotes healthy and balanced landscaping but likewise enhances water conservation, eventually expanding the lifespan of the lawn sprinkler while maximizing its effectiveness.

Exactly how Do I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ler?
To winterize a lawn sprinkler, one should first turn off the water supply, after that drain the system totally. Additionally, utilizing pressed air to blow out remaining water from the lines stops cold and prospective damages.
